Email
Enterprise Service
menu
Email
Enterprise Service
Submit
Basic information
Waiting for a reply
Your form has been submitted. We'll contact you in 24 hours.
Close
Home/ Blog/ How can I evaluate the IP refresh speed of PyProxy and NetNut?

How can I evaluate the IP refresh speed of PyProxy and NetNut?

PYPROXY PYPROXY · May 09, 2025

When evaluating IP rotation services like PYPROXY and NetNut, one of the most critical factors to consider is the IP refresh speed. IP rotation speed can have a significant impact on the performance and effectiveness of your web scraping, data mining, or any task that requires anonymity and large-scale data extraction. The refresh rate of IPs determines how quickly new IP addresses are assigned during a task, and it is essential to understand how these services differ in this regard. In this article, we will explore how to assess the IP rotation speed of both PyProxy and NetNut, considering different factors like server response time, availability of IP pools, and how each service impacts overall task efficiency.

Introduction: Why IP Rotation Speed Matters

IP rotation services are commonly used to mask users' real IP addresses and bypass geographical or security restrictions on websites. Both PyProxy and NetNut offer rotating proxies, but the speed at which these proxies are refreshed plays a crucial role in maximizing efficiency and minimizing disruptions. A faster IP refresh rate ensures smoother web scraping, reduces the risk of being flagged as a bot, and helps maintain data accuracy.

IP refresh speed can also influence several other critical aspects, including response times, the consistency of IP availability, and how frequently users might encounter issues like IP blacklisting or throttling. Evaluating these factors accurately requires an in-depth understanding of the technology behind the service, and its real-world impact on your tasks.

Factors Influencing IP Refresh Speed

The speed of IP rotation is determined by several factors, including the infrastructure of the proxy service, the quality of the IP pool, and the mechanism used to assign new IPs. Understanding these factors is key to evaluating how well PyProxy and NetNut perform when it comes to IP refresh speed.

1. Proxy Pool Size and Quality

The quality of the IP pool is crucial when evaluating IP rotation speed. A proxy service with a larger, high-quality pool of IP addresses will be able to refresh IPs more frequently without running into limitations. PyProxy and NetNut both provide access to large proxy networks, but differences in the size and quality of their IP pools can affect refresh speed.

- PyProxy: Known for a large number of IPs spread across multiple geographical regions, PyProxy’s IP pool offers a wide variety of addresses, but the refresh speed can vary based on the demand for specific locations and times of day.

- NetNut: With a highly optimized proxy pool, NetNut offers IPs from a range of countries. NetNut’s network tends to focus on providing consistent and high-quality IPs, which can lead to faster IP refresh rates during continuous scraping tasks.

A larger IP pool can result in fewer delays when refreshing IPs, as the system has a broader selection to choose from, reducing the chances of using a blacklisted or slow IP.

2. Proxy Type: Residential vs. Data Center Proxies

Both PyProxy and NetNut offer residential proxies, which are typically more stable and less likely to be blocked compared to data center proxies. However, the refresh rate can differ depending on the type of proxies used.

- Residential Proxies: These proxies are tied to real devices, making them harder to detect and block. While they tend to be slower to refresh compared to data center proxies, they offer greater anonymity and reliability. Both PyProxy and NetNut use residential IPs for a significant portion of their proxy pool, which impacts their IP refresh rates.

- Data Center Proxies: These are typically faster to refresh because they are hosted on dedicated servers, but they can be more easily detected and blocked. NetNut focuses on optimizing residential proxies, whereas PyProxy offers a combination of both residential and data center proxies.

3. Technology and Infrastructure

The technology behind how IP addresses are rotated is another key factor influencing refresh speed. This includes the algorithms used to assign new IPs, as well as the infrastructure that supports the proxy network.

- PyProxy: The infrastructure of PyProxy is designed to prioritize speed, but this may come at the cost of occasional instability. PyProxy’s algorithms can allocate new IPs fairly quickly, but at times, users may experience minor delays if there are too many simultaneous requests.

- NetNut: NetNut uses a more robust backend infrastructure to support a higher level of scalability and faster refresh speeds. Their technology ensures that IPs are allocated dynamically and quickly, resulting in better performance in environments that demand frequent IP rotations.

4. Load Balancing and Server Response Time

The server response time and how traffic is distributed across the network play significant roles in IP refresh speed. An optimized load balancing system can ensure that the server does not become overwhelmed, thus preventing delays in IP refresh.

- PyProxy: While PyProxy is designed for high-speed performance, its load balancing system may occasionally face congestion, leading to slower IP rotations during peak hours.

- NetNut: NetNut’s infrastructure is typically better optimized for load balancing, ensuring that IP refresh rates are consistent even under heavy traffic loads.

5. Geographical Distribution of IPs

The geographical location of the proxy servers can also affect the refresh speed. If IP addresses are assigned from a specific country or region, users may experience slower refresh rates if the proxy network doesn’t have sufficient coverage in that region.

- PyProxy: The geographical diversity of PyProxy’s proxy pool allows for greater flexibility, but refresh speeds can be slower for less common regions due to lower IP availability.

- NetNut: While NetNut offers global coverage, their network’s focus on specific regions may provide a faster IP refresh speed in certain geographical areas.

Practical Considerations: How to Test IP Refresh Speed

To assess the IP refresh speed of PyProxy and NetNut, conducting real-world tests under varying conditions is essential. Here are some ways to do so:

1. Monitoring IP Refresh Rates in Real-Time

One of the simplest ways to evaluate IP refresh speed is by monitoring the speed at which IP addresses change during tasks like web scraping or automated data mining. Keep track of how frequently IP addresses are rotated and whether delays occur during the refresh process. Record the time it takes for a new IP to be assigned and check whether there are any interruptions in the flow of your tasks.

2. Analyzing Response Times and Error Rates

While testing, keep an eye on the response times and any error messages (such as IP blacklisting or timeouts). A slow refresh rate can often result in increased error rates, which can impact the overall performance of your task. By analyzing these response times, you can determine how effectively each service handles IP rotations during high-demand scenarios.

Conclusion: Which Service Offers Better IP Refresh Speed?

Both PyProxy and NetNut offer strong IP rotation services, but they have different strengths when it comes to IP refresh speed. PyProxy excels in providing a large and diverse IP pool, but refresh rates can vary depending on the region and demand. NetNut, on the other hand, offers faster and more consistent IP refresh rates due to its highly optimized infrastructure and focus on residential proxies.

For users who prioritize high-speed IP rotations and minimal downtime, NetNut may offer a better solution. However, if you need a more flexible proxy pool with diverse geographical coverage, PyProxy could be the more suitable choice.

Ultimately, the best choice depends on your specific needs—whether it’s higher speed, more diverse IP options, or geographical flexibility. Conducting hands-on tests and monitoring performance will give you the most accurate insights into which service meets your needs.

Related Posts